| Text: | O God, Thy World Is Sweet with Prayer |
| Author: | Lucy Larcom |
| Tune: | CANONBURY |
| Composer: | Robert Alexander Schumann |
| Media: | MIDI file |
1. O God, Thy world is sweet with prayer;
The breath of Christ is in the air;
We rise on Thy free Spirit’s wings,
And every thought within us sings.
2. Thou art our morning and our sun,
Our work is glad, in Thee begun;
Our foot worn path is fresh with dew,
For Thou createst all things new.
3. O God, within us and above,
Close to us in the Christ we love,
Through Him, our only guide and way,
May heavenly life be ours today!
